What is Cobalt? A Deep Dive into Its Properties and Importance
Cobalt is a hard, lustrous, silver-gray metal with unique chemical and physical properties that make it highly valuable across numerous industrial applications. Discovered in the 18th century, its name is derived from the German word “kobold,” meaning goblin, a nod to the mythical creatures miners believed inhabited the earth and interfered with their ore extraction. Today, cobalt is recognized not for superstition, but for its critical role in enhancing the performance and durability of advanced materials.
Its high electrochemical potential makes it ideal for cathodes in rechargeable batteries, significantly increasing energy density and longevity. In aerospace, cobalt-based superalloys are crucial for manufacturing jet engine turbine blades due to their exceptional resistance to heat, corrosion, and fatigue. Furthermore, cobalt compounds are used as pigments in ceramics and glass, catalysts in chemical processes, and in various other specialized applications, highlighting its versatility and indispensable nature in modern manufacturing.
The Global Cobalt Market: Supply, Demand, and Price Trends
The global cobalt market is characterized by significant demand driven by the booming EV and consumer electronics sectors, coupled with a concentrated supply base. The Democratic Republic of Congo (DRC) is by far the largest producer, accounting for over 70% of global mine production. This concentration presents both opportunities and challenges for market stability and ethical sourcing, making supply chain transparency a critical concern for buyers worldwide.
- Demand Drivers: The exponential growth in electric vehicles is the primary catalyst for cobalt demand. As governments worldwide push for decarbonization and renewable energy solutions, the need for high-energy-density batteries, where cobalt plays a key role, continues to escalate. Consumer electronics, including smartphones, laptops, and wearables, also contribute significantly to cobalt consumption.
- Supply Landscape: While the DRC dominates, other countries like Canada, Australia, Cuba, and Russia contribute smaller but significant amounts to the global supply. The mining and refining processes for cobalt are complex and often energy-intensive, requiring substantial investment and adherence to stringent environmental and social governance (ESG) standards.
- Price Volatility: Cobalt prices have historically been volatile due to supply chain disruptions, geopolitical factors, and speculative trading. In 2026, the market is closely watched for any potential price fluctuations that could impact manufacturing costs for industries reliant on this critical mineral.
Applications of Cobalt: Powering Innovation Across Industries
Cobalt’s unique properties lend themselves to a diverse range of high-impact applications, making it a cornerstone of modern industrial progress. Its contribution extends from the everyday devices in our pockets to the advanced machinery that powers global industries, underscoring its status as a strategic mineral in the 21st century.
- Rechargeable Batteries: This is the dominant application for cobalt, accounting for over 60% of its use. Cobalt’s presence in lithium-ion battery cathodes (like NMC – Nickel Manganese Cobalt, and NCA – Nickel Cobalt Aluminum) enhances energy density, power output, and battery lifespan. This is critical for electric vehicles, portable electronics, and energy storage systems, aligning perfectly with France’s commitment to green energy solutions.
- Superalloys: Cobalt is a key ingredient in superalloys used in high-temperature environments, such as jet engine turbine blades and gas turbines for power generation. These alloys maintain their strength and resistance to creep and corrosion at extreme temperatures, ensuring the safety and efficiency of critical aerospace and industrial equipment.
- Magnets: Cobalt is essential for producing powerful permanent magnets, particularly samarium-cobalt magnets, which offer excellent magnetic strength and stability at high temperatures. These magnets are vital for motors in EVs, wind turbines, and various electronic devices.
- Pigments and Catalysts: Cobalt compounds impart vibrant blue colors to glass, ceramics, and paints. In the chemical industry, cobalt serves as a catalyst in processes like petroleum refining and the production of synthetic fuels and plastics.
- Other Uses: Cobalt finds applications in medical isotopes for cancer treatment, as a binder in cemented carbides for cutting tools, and in wear-resistant coatings.

Ethical Sourcing and Sustainability in Cobalt Mining
The significant reliance on cobalt, particularly from the Democratic Republic of Congo, has brought ethical sourcing and sustainability to the forefront of industry and consumer concerns. Reports of child labor, unsafe working conditions, and environmental degradation in artisanal and small-scale mining (ASM) operations necessitate a rigorous approach to supply chain transparency and responsible sourcing practices.
